I've got a 87 turbo II with a hybrid turbo. I'm Upgrading the fuel pump to a walbro 255, 720cc injectors, Boost cut defender, and I'm not sure what kind of regulator yet. anyway my question is what is the Max boost on a stock port... I was thinking like 10 PSI's on the stock ECU, and then like maybe 15+PSI with E6K or Microtech. Is that possible on a stock port? if so is it dangerous? My goal is to up the boost and gain HP, the safest way possible.

I was running 17-18 PSI with a very mild port on a TII motor with a Greddy T-78. It worked well. The maximum boost you can run will depend on the turbo and fuel management. A hybrid would probably max out around 17 PSI. 15 would be safer.
